I was 12 when Batman came on TV in 1966. It was huge, at least in my demographic:roflmao:...
the theme song, the Batmobile, the primary colors, the guest villains, the hips on Julie Newmar, the pow/bam/zap fight graphics, the merchandizing...me and every kid in my neighborhood had t-shirts like this:
batmantshirt.jpg

images

One of the few show that was so popular they broadcast two episodes each week on different nights in prime time. Then passé and cancelled after three years.
